Re: 870TB LOP?
The standard LOP on a Remington trap shotgun is 14 1/2". But, that can vary from user to user depending on if they want a custom fit. "Length or the shotgun length of pull is the measurement between the centre of the trigger and the centre of the butt. Typically, this will range anywhere f...
